Web21 Sep 2024 · Postural tachycardia syndrome (PoTS) is an abnormal response of your body when you are upright (usually when standing). It is caused by a problem with the nervous system which controls the autonomic functions in the body. This part of the nervous system is called the autonomic nervous system. WebPOTS has several possible symptoms, and they vary from person to person. Symptoms include: Dizziness or lightheadedness, especially when standing up, during prolonged standing in one position or on long walks. Fainting or near fainting. Forgetfulness and trouble focusing (brain fog). Heart palpitations or racing heart rate. Exhaustion/fatigue.
